Concrete driveway installation involves preparing the site, pouring the concrete, and finishing the surface to create a durable and smooth driveway. This process typically begins with site assessment and excavation, ensuring the ground is properly graded and compacted to support the concrete. Once the base is prepared, forms are set to define the driveway’s shape, and reinforcement materials like steel rebar may be added for extra strength. The concrete is then poured, leveled, and finished with techniques that create a clean, even surface suitable for everyday use.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Driveway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Glenview,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or driveway repairs, such as crack filling or patching, usually range from $250 to $600. Many routine maintenance jobs fall within this middle range, though prices can vary based on the extent of damage and local contractor rates.

Standard Driveway Installation - Installing a new concrete driveway generally costs between $3,000 and $7,000 for most residential projects. Larger, more complex installations or those with custom finishes can reach $8,000 or more, while simpler jobs tend to stay in the lower part of this range.

Full Replacement - Replacing an existing driveway with a new concrete surface typically ranges from $4,500 to $10,000. Many projects fall into this middle to upper range, depending on size, site preparation needs, and design preferences, with fewer jobs exceeding $12,000.

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Larger or highly customized concrete driveway projects, such as those involving decorative finishes or extensive grading, can cost $10,000 to $20,000 or more. These tend to be less common and are usually tailored to specific design requirements or property sizes.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of choosing concrete for a driveway? Concrete driveways are durable, low maintenance, and can enhance the curb appeal of a property, making them a popular choice for many homeowners in Glenview, IL.

How do local contractors prepare the area for concrete driveway installation? Contractors typically clear the site, remove existing pavement if necessary, and prepare a stable base to ensure proper drainage and a long-lasting driveway.

Can concrete driveways be customized in appearance? Yes, local service providers often offer options such as staining, stamping, or adding decorative finishes to achieve a specific look or style.

What factors influence the longevity of a concrete driveway? Proper installation, quality materials, and regular maintenance can help extend the lifespan of a concrete driveway handled by experienced local contractors.

How do local service providers ensure proper drainage for concrete driveways? Contractors design the driveway with appropriate slope and drainage features to prevent water pooling and protect the foundation over time.
